Associate Director, Planning

4 months ago


Chicago, United States Starcom Full time

**Company Description** Who is Starcom**:
**Job Description** What You’ll Do**:
The Associate Director, Planning oversees a media planning team and manages cross-media strategy and planning campaigns. The Associate Director owns planning activities for complex or large spend campaigns, and is responsible for generating strategic insights while driving learnings across the full suite of the client’s activities.

**Responsibilities**:

- Strategize with internal directors and client to develop innovative, well-targeted marketing solutions
- Interface with clients and partner agencies to build strategic communication plans for targeted audiences
- Review client deliverables for quality, ensuring that recommendations and work product are sound and viable
- Own the development of strategic proposals and client facing POVs, coordinating with necessary teams to account for all relevant inputs
- Assume accountability and ownership of campaign planning for assigned client accounts
- Embrace and encourage a culture based on teamwork, collaboration, and support
- Develop best practices for improving communication and collaboration within the team and the group
- Lead knowledge share sessions to share and learn new strategies for optimizing and enhancing campaign performance
- Collaborate and foster relationships with key partners including clients, internal teams, and leadership
- Lead strategic planning initiatives including deck writing, budget and channel allocation, and audience development
- Serve as escalation point for teams to help troubleshoot issues
- Support development of strategic approach and experience design by delivering channel ideas and providing the link to reality of historical performance and in-market opportunities
- Responsible for management and development of Associates, Senior Associates, and Supervisors

**Qualifications** Qualifications**:

- Bachelor’s degree preferred, preferably with a concentration in marketing, advertising, communications, business, sociology, or consumer insights
- 5+ years of experience in media planning/strategy experience across media channels
- Previous team management experience
- Strong digital media experience preferred
- Resourceful, curious, and motivated individual with an ability to work independently as well as in a team setting
- Ability to manage timelines, projects and personnel within direct report team and across cross-functional teams
- Proven experience in successfully managing multiple work streams at one time
- Strong organizational, communication, and time-management skills
- Excellent presentation skills to effectively lead meetings in-person with key clients
- Detail-oriented with the ability to multi-task and manage priorities and deadlines in a fast-paced environment
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ite with strong understanding of Excel and PowerPoint
- Experience working within media systems/platforms (Kantar, MOAT, Prisma, ComScore etc.)
